Of the Max Veytsman
On IncludeSec we specialize in software defense comparison in regards to our clients, it means delivering apps aside and you may searching for extremely crazy vulnerabilities prior to other hackers would. When we have enough time off from client work we love so you can get to know preferred applications to see what we should see. By the end of 2013 we found a susceptability one allows you get direct latitude and longitude co-ordinates for your Tinder associate (that has due to the fact started repaired)
Tinder is actually an extremely prominent matchmaking app. It gifts an individual having images of visitors and you may allows him or her to “like” or “nope” him or her. When two different people “like” both, a talk package pops up permitting them to chat. What would-be simpler?
Being a matchmaking app, it is necessary that Tinder demonstrates to you attractive single people near you. To that particular prevent, Tinder lets you know what lengths away potential matches is actually:
Prior to i continue, just a bit of history: Within the , another Confidentiality vulnerability try claimed during the Tinder by the several other security researcher. At the time, Tinder was actually giving latitude and you will longitude co-ordinates out of prospective matches towards ios customer. You aren’t standard coding knowledge you are going to inquire the newest Tinder API privately and you can pull-down the fresh co-ordinates of any user. I’ll talk about a separate susceptability which is connected with how that described above is repaired. During the applying the enhance, Tinder introduced yet another vulnerability which is explained lower than.
This new API
Because of the proxying iphone requests, you can score an image of the API the fresh Tinder software uses. Interesting to us now ‘s the associate endpoint, hence efficiency details about a person of the id. This can be titled of the client for the potential suits given that you swipe through images regarding application. The following is a snippet of your own impulse:
Tinder has stopped being returning specific GPS co-ordinates because of its profiles, but it is leaking some area pointers you to an tanner sugar daddy websites attack is also exploit. The distance_mi industry are a beneficial 64-section twice. That’s a great amount of precision you to we have been taking, and it’s enough to carry out extremely perfect triangulation!
Triangulation
As much as large-college sufferers go, trigonometry is not the preferred, so i won’t enter way too many facts here. Essentially, if you have about three (or more) point specifications to a target away from identified urban centers, you can get an outright located area of the address using triangulation step one . That is similar in theory so you can exactly how GPS and you will cellphone location features works. I’m able to perform a visibility to the Tinder, utilize the API to share with Tinder you to definitely I’m during the particular arbitrary location, and you will query brand new API to obtain a radius to a user. Whenever i understand area my personal target stays in, We create step three fake profile to your Tinder. Then i share with the fresh new Tinder API which i are at around three urban centers doing in which I guess my personal address is actually. Then i normally plug the brand new distances to the formula with this Wikipedia web page.
TinderFinder
In advance of I-go into, it app isn’t online and we have zero arrangements towards the introducing they. This is a critical susceptability, therefore in no way must assist someone consume new privacy away from someone else. TinderFinder was designed to demonstrate a susceptability and just looked at with the Tinder membership that i had control over. TinderFinder works by which have you type in the consumer id of a beneficial address (or use your individual by signing into the Tinder). It is assumed that an attacker will find user ids pretty effortlessly of the sniffing this new phone’s traffic to find them. Very first, the consumer calibrates this new lookup to help you a region. I’m choosing a time in Toronto, because I’m wanting me. I’m able to locate any office I sat in the while creating the latest app: I can also go into a person-id actually: And find a goal Tinder associate during the Ny You can find videos demonstrating the app work in more detail lower than:
Q: How much does which susceptability succeed that create? A: It vulnerability lets any Tinder affiliate to get the precise venue of some other tinder affiliate which have a really high amount of accuracy (inside 100ft from your studies) Q: So is this form of drawback certain to Tinder? A: No way, faults for the place pointers addressing was basically prominent input this new mobile application area and you will still will always be well-known in the event that developers never handle venue advice way more sensitively. Q: Performs this supply the place regarding an effective user’s last sign-for the or once they signed up? or perhaps is it genuine-date place record? A: Which susceptability finds the very last venue the user said so you’re able to Tinder, which usually happens when they last had the application discover. Q: How would you like Fb for this attack be effective? A: If you are all of our Proof of design attack spends Fb authentication to get the newest user’s Tinder id, Facebook is not required to mine it vulnerability, and no action by the Myspace could mitigate it vulnerability Q: Is it about brand new vulnerability included in Tinder the 2009 12 months? A: Yes it is linked to a similar area one to an equivalent Confidentiality susceptability is actually included in . During the time the applying tissues alter Tinder built to correct the latest confidentiality vulnerability was not proper, they changed the fresh JSON data off perfect lat/enough time in order to an extremely precise length. Maximum and you may Erik of Include Protection was able to extract direct location analysis from this using triangulation. Q: Just how performed Include Safety alert Tinder and you may just what recommendation gotten? A: We have maybe not over lookup to ascertain how much time which flaw has been around, we think you are able so it flaw ‘s been around given that augment is made into the earlier in the day privacy flaw for the is why recommendation to possess removal is to try to never ever manage high resolution size of range or location in any sense with the buyer-side. This type of computations should be done towards the servers-front to quit the possibility of the client apps intercepting the latest positional guidance. Instead using reasonable-reliability status/range symptoms will allow the ability and you can application frameworks to remain unchanged if you are deleting the ability to restrict an exact position of another user. Q: Is anyone exploiting so it? How can i know if some body possess monitored me personally with this specific privacy vulnerability? A: Brand new API calls utilized in that it proof of style trial try not unique at all, they don’t assault Tinder’s server plus they play with data which the newest Tinder websites features exports intentionally. There is absolutely no smart way to determine whether or not it attack was used up against a particular Tinder affiliate.
